Job Description:Status: Part TimeShift: 3rdHours: 24**Sign-on bonus eligible**ICUICU is a critical care unit specializing in neurologic care. Staff on ICU will encounter stroke, post-op neurosurgery, ventricular drains, abdominal pressure monitoring, CRRT, hypothermia, etc. Care ranges from young adult through geriatric patient population. Job SummaryRegistered nurse implements the nursing process for each assigned to his/her care regardless of age and is responsible for the patient's care consistent with the Kentucky Nursing Laws and organizational policies and procedures. The registered nurse promotes positive patient outcomes and the delivery of quality patient care and initiates change through active involvement in the unit-based and hospital shared governance councils while contributing to a healthy professional practice environment.Principal Duties and ResponsibilitiesThe following is a summary of the major functions of this position. Registered nurses may perform other duties, not specified in this document and specific functions may change as professional practice and standards evolve.1. Performs assessment/reassessment2. Develops plan of care utilizing appropriate evidence based standards of care.3. Provides care consistent with policies, procedures, current evidence based professional standards of practice and Baptist Health Louisville's nursing mission, vision, values and model of care.4. Evaluates patient response to treatment5. Applies critical thinking, clinical reasoning, organizational and leadership skills.Minimum Education, Training, and Experience1. Active Kentucky RN License2. BCLS required3. ACLS required within six (6) months for experienced nurses and within twelve (12) months for new graduate nurses.If you would like to be part of a growing family focused on supporting clinical excellence, teamwork and innovation, we urge you to apply now!Baptist Health is an Equal Employment Opportunity employer.

Baptist Health of Arkansas: Dedicated to Wellness, Driven by Purpose On February 16, 1921, the Pulaski County Circuit Court ordered the incorporation of Baptist State Hospital, and the organization that would eventually grow into the Baptist Health system was born. Though the original hospital opened its doors in Little Rock with less than a hundred beds in a small building, the purpose was significant create a healthier community through Christian compassion and innovative services. While much has changed over the past century, our goal has remained the same and has served as the driving for ... ce behind all weve accomplished. Today, Baptist Health is Arkansas most comprehensive healthcare organization with more than 200 points of access that include 11 hospitals, urgent care centers, a senior living community, and over 100 primary and specialty care clinics in Arkansas and eastern Oklahoma. The system additionally offers a college with studies in nursing and allied health, a graduate residency program, and access to virtual care through a mobile app. Baptist Health, as the largest not-for-profit health care organization based in Arkansas, provides care to patients wherever they are through the support of approximately 11,000 employees, groundbreaking treatments, renowned physicians, and community outreach programs.
